解决织梦DedeCMS投票模块漏洞的方法
织梦DedeCMS是一款流行的内容管理系统,但在其投票模块中存在一些安全漏洞,可能导致网站被恶意攻击,以下是一些详细准确的解决方法,以帮助用户修复这些漏洞。
1. 更新系统
步骤:检查是否可以使用织梦CMS官方提供的最新版本进行更新。
理由:官方版本通常会修复已知的漏洞,更新到最新版本可以减少被攻击的风险。
2. 修改配置文件
步骤:
1. 进入织梦CMS的根目录,找到inc_config.php
文件。
2. 在该文件中找到safe_check
配置项,确保其值设置为1
。
3. 修改vote_isopen
配置项,将其设置为0
以关闭投票功能,或者确保投票模块的配置项正确设置。
理由:通过修改配置文件,可以关闭或正确配置投票模块,减少漏洞被利用的可能性。
3. 修改数据库
步骤:
1. 使用数据库管理工具(如phpMyAdmin)连接到织梦CMS的数据库。
2. 找到投票模块相关的表,例如vote_data
。
3. 检查表中是否有异常数据或恶意插入的数据,如有,则删除或修复。
理由:清理数据库中的异常数据可以防止恶意数据被利用。
4. 代码审查
步骤:
1. 下载并检查织梦CMS投票模块的源代码。
2. 寻找可能存在漏洞的代码片段,如输入验证不足、SQL注入点等。
3. 修复或更新这些代码片段,确保数据安全和代码健壮性。
理由:代码审查可以帮助发现并修复潜在的安全漏洞。
5. 使用安全插件
步骤:
1. 在织梦CMS应用市场中搜索安全插件。
2. 选择适合的插件,并按照插件说明进行安装和配置。
理由:安全插件可以帮助增强网站的安全性。
6. 定期备份
步骤:
1. 定期备份网站数据和数据库。
2. 将备份存储在安全的位置。
理由:即使发生安全事件,也能通过备份恢复网站。
通过上述方法,可以有效解决织梦DedeCMS投票模块的漏洞问题,提高网站的安全性,建议用户定期检查网站安全,并及时更新和维护系统。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1175641.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复